    I haven't fed since pretty much the pond has been finished, which was towards the end of autumn. Then the winter hit so definitely didn't feed then due to low temps and a mixture of hardly any bacteria too.
    But now I've just this week fitted a heater and I am slowly bringing the water temperature up to get it to around 15c. Would you still feed a wheat germ in this instance and at what temperature would you be happy to start feeding high protein? Im a little reluctant to start feeding high protein due to the low bacteria levels currently. Thanks

    • @junction-27koicarp22
      @junction-27koicarp22  2 ปีที่แล้ว +1

      Had my showa damaged its eye trying to spawn in reeds last year but its all healing nicely I would still feed wheatgerm for a few weeks after 12 degrees and slowly up the feed over a few weeks to let bacteria grow nitrifying bacteria stays alive down to 5 degrees ponds just don't have alot after winter cos there is not alot of ammonia for it to feed on so it starves and shrinks
